@charset "utf-8";
/* CSS Document */

/*/////////////////////TYPE AVEC MENU/////////////////*/
.BoxTopTitre {	
height:30px;
width:auto;
overflow:hidden;
}

.BoxTopTitreGauche{
height:30px;
width:264px;
background-image:url(../images/site/box/titre-gauche.png);
background-repeat:no-repeat;
padding-left:30px;
padding-top:2px;
float:left;
}

.BoxTopTitreDroiteXl{
height:32px;
width:289px;
background-image:url(../images/site/box/titre-droite.png);
background-repeat:no-repeat;
display:block;
margin-left:521px;
margin-top:-32px;
}

.BoxTopTitreDroite{
background-image:url(../images/site/box/titre-droite.png);
background-repeat:no-repeat;
height:25px !important;
padding-left:130px;
padding-top:7px;
width:159px;
}


.BoxTopTitreCentre{
height:32px;
width:17px;
background-image:url(../images/site/box/titre-bande-pixel.png);
background-repeat:repeat-x;
}

.BoxBottomTitre{
display:block;
width:600px;
height:35px;
}

.BoxBottomTitreLeft
{
width:294px;
height:35px;
background: transparent url(../images/site/box/bas-gauche.png) no-repeat;
}
.BoxBottomTitreCentre
{
width:17px;
height:35px;
background:url(../images/site/box/bas-bande-pixel.png) repeat-x;
}
.BoxBottomTitreRight
{
width:259px;
height:34px;
background:url(../images/site/box/bas-droite.png) no-repeat;
text-align:right;
padding-right:30px;
padding-bottom:1px;
}

.BoxPixel{
background:url(../images/site/box/bande-pixel.png) repeat-y;
}



/*/////////////////////TYPE MENU XL/////////////////*/
.BoxTopTitreXl{	
height:30px;
width:808px;
overflow:hidden;
}

.BoxTopTitreCentreXl{
display:block;
height:32px;
width:227px;
background-image:url(../images/site/box/titre-bande-pixel.png);
background-repeat:repeat-x;
}

.BoxBottomTitreXl{
display:block;
width:810px;
height:35px;
}

.BoxBottomTitreCentreXl{
width:227px;
height:35px;
background:url(../images/site/box/bas-bande-pixel.png) repeat-x;
}

.BoxPixelXl{
background:url(../images/site/box/bande-pixel-xl.png) repeat-y transparent;
height:auto;
width:808px;
}

/*/////////////////////TYPE AVEC MENU COLLE/////////////////*/
.BoxTopTitre_xs {
display:block;
height:28px;
width:582px;
background: url(../images/site/box/xs/new-top-col-droite-top.png) no-repeat;
/*background-color:#000000;*/
padding-left:28px;
padding-top:2px;
overflow:hidden;
margin:0;
}

.BoxBottomTitre_xs
{
display:block;
width:610px;
height:35px;
background: url(../images/site/box/xs/new-top-col-droite-bas.png) no-repeat;
}


.BoxPixel_xs{
width: 610px;
background: url(../images/site/box/xs/bande-pixel.png) repeat-y;
}

/*SKIN BOX CONTENT*/

/*SANS ACCORDEON*/
	
a.BoxContentTitre{
display:block;
position:static;
height:33px;
width:588px;
-moz-border-radius: 0px;
-webkit-border-radius: 0px;
background:url(../images/site/news/news.jpg) 0px -33px no-repeat;
margin-left:6px;
border:0px;
margin-top:0px;
padding-top:0;
}

a.BoxContentTitre span.logowapper {
display:block;
float:left;
padding-top:4px;
padding-left:35px;
}

a.BoxContentTitre span.titlewapper {
display:block;
float:left;
margin-top:2px;
margin-left:10px;
width:500px;
overflow:hidden;
font-weight:bold;
color:#000;
}

a.BoxContentTitre span.infowapper {
display:block;
float:left;
margin-left:10px;
margin-top:1px;
width:350px;
overflow:hidden;

color:#666;
}

a.newslink1st{
display:block;
position:static;
height:33px;
width:588px;
-moz-border-radius: 0px;
-webkit-border-radius: 0px;
background:url(../images/site/news/news-haut.jpg) 0px 0px no-repeat;
margin-left:6px;
border:0px;
margin-top:0px;
padding-top:0px;
}
a.newslink1stOpen{
display:block;
position:static;
height:33px;
width:588px;
-moz-border-radius: 0px;
-webkit-border-radius: 0px;
background:url(../images/site/news/news-haut.jpg) 0px -33px no-repeat;
margin-left:6px;
border:0px;
margin-top:0px;
padding-top:0px;
}
div.BoxContentHeader{
width:588px;
height:9px;
background:url(../images/site/news/news-ouvert-haut.jpg) no-repeat;
margin-left:6px;
margin-top:0px;
padding:0px;
cursor:default;
}
div.BoxContent{
display:block;
width:562px;
padding-left:13px;
padding-bottom:0px;
overflow:hidden;
background:url(../images/site/news/news-ouvert-pixel.jpg) repeat-y;
margin-left:6px;
cursor:default;
text-align:justify;
}
div.BoxContentFooter{
width:588px;
height:16px;
background:url(../images/site/news/news-ouvert-bas.jpg) no-repeat;
margin-left:6px;
margin-bottom:0px;
padding:0px;
cursor:default;
}

/*/////////////////////////////////*/

a.BoxContentTitreXs {
display:block;
position:static;
height:33px;
width:590px;
-moz-border-radius: 0px;
-webkit-border-radius: 0px;
background:url(../images/site/devzone/titre.jpg) 0px -33px no-repeat;
margin-left:6px;
border:0px;
margin-top:0px;
padding-top:0;
}

a.BoxContentTitreXs span.logowapper {
display:block;
float:left;
padding-top:4px;
padding-left:35px;
}

a.BoxContentTitreXs span.titlewapper {
display:block;
float:left;
margin-top:2px;
margin-left:10px;

width:350px;
overflow:hidden;

color:black;
font-weight:bold;
}

a.BoxContentTitreXs span.infowapper {
display:block;
float:left;
margin-left:10px;
margin-top:1px;
width:350px;
overflow:hidden;
color:#666;
}

div.BoxContentHeaderXs{
width:590px;
height:9px;
background:url(../images/site/devzone/news-ouvert-haut.jpg) no-repeat;
margin-left:6px;
margin-top:0px;
padding:0px;
cursor:default;
}
div.BoxContentXs{
display:block;
width:564px;
padding-left:13px;
padding-right:13px;
padding-bottom:0px;
padding-top:5px;
overflow:hidden;
background:url(../images/site/devzone/news-ouvert-pixel.jpg) repeat-y;
margin-left:6px;
cursor:default;
text-align:justify;
height:auto;
}
div.BoxContentFooterXs{
width:590px;
height:16px;
background:url(../images/site/devzone/news-ouvert-bas.jpg) no-repeat;
margin-left:6px;
margin-bottom:0px;
padding:0px;
cursor:default;
}




